Codevision Avr 2050 Professional

While legacy versions focused primarily on the ATmega and ATtiny series, the 2050 Professional edition features comprehensive, native support for modern architectures:

CodeVisionAVR Professional remains a robust, reliable, and highly efficient solution for 8-bit AVR development. Its combination of an advanced C compiler, an easy-to-use Wizard, and built-in programming tools makes it an ideal choice for both embedded professionals and those working on complex, resource-constrained projects. codevision avr 2050 professional

In an industry where development tools are often fragmented—requiring a separate IDE, compiler, debugger, and programmer—CodeVisionAVR 2050 Professional offers a unified solution. It integrates the editor, compiler, and programmer software into a single, stable package. While modern trends lean toward Eclipse or Visual Studio Code-based environments, there is a distinct advantage to the lightweight, responsive nature of CodeVisionAVR. It does not suffer from the bloat associated with modern IDEs, launching quickly and running smoothly on older hardware, which is often still found in industrial workshops. While legacy versions focused primarily on the ATmega

The certified libraries and static memory allocation (no dynamic malloc ) make it suitable for infusion pumps, patient monitors, and disposable diagnostic tools. It integrates the editor, compiler, and programmer software

Stores executable code and constant data using the flash keyword.

Instead of manual register configuration, the wizard generates initialization code instantly, drastically reducing the "setup" phase of a project. 2. Optimized C Compiler